Analysis

In 2018, netherlands (kingdom of the) — paper and paperboard, excluding in Sweden stood at 601,478 t.

The figure is up 19.3% on the previous year and down 19.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, netherlands (kingdom of the) — paper and paperboard, excluding in Sweden peaked at 798,000 t in 2007 and was at its lowest, 455,500 t, in 2002.

That places Sweden 2nd out of 70 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
